The Value Gap

Loyalty is a value gap. Most companies only ever build part of what closes it.

Every decade rewrites the mechanic — punch cards, points, apps, AI personalisation. What never changes is this: technology is one leg of loyalty. The relationship is the system. Four capabilities build it — mechanics, relationship, brand experience and commercial model — and almost no one owns all four. Most brands buy them from four different vendors, then wonder why retention still doesn't move.

What was — transactional

Buy. Earn. Redeem.

Price and points lead the choice. Communication follows the campaign calendar. Success is measured in transactions. Easy to compare. Easy to replace.

What's next — relational

Listen. Understand. Help. Surprise.

Recognition and relevance lead the choice. Behaviour shapes the next interaction. Success is measured in preference, retention and value. Harder to compare. Harder to leave.

Retention compounds over time. Bought volume must be funded again every year.

Transformations I have led

2022 – 2024

Corporate Rebrand: Nordic Choice Hotels → Strawberry

Led the loyalty and experience repositioning as Scandinavia's largest hotel group transitioned identities. Developed new member benefits, integrated experience partnerships into a new narrative, ensured GTM campaigns supported the transition across 300+ hotels — with zero loss in member value or commercial momentum.

→ CLV up 62% · +15% incremental revenue (~38 MSEK) · +10% volume shift to direct channels
2022 – 2025

SPENN Loyalty Currency Integration

Strategic movement into a groundbreaking external multi-owner Nordic loyalty platform with Norwegian Air and Reitan. Aligned acquisition logic, transaction flows, and member engagement across industry giants — managing startup-vs-corporate friction in a complex multi-owner environment.

→ Seamless ecosystem transition · Unified currency flow · Sustained member stickiness
2024 – 2025

Partnership Strategy & Organizational Restructuring

Complete overhaul of a 30+ partner portfolio and design of a new organisational business unit. Analysed portfolio revenue impact, defined new governance model with KPIs and budget logic, shifted organisation from campaign-based tasks to a structured, long-term ecosystem model.

→ New governance model · Structured P&L framework · Scalable ecosystem architecture
2021 – 2023

Place Branding & Destination Collaboration — Gothenburg & Oslo

Strategic alignment of hospitality, culture and commercial partners within city-level place branding frameworks. Integrated experience-led activation into urban positioning strategies, connecting corporate ecosystem strategy with destination attractiveness through public-private partnerships.

→ Enhanced regional positioning · Cross-market brand consistency · Long-term destination value
